El GiFT es un tema que ha captado la atención de millones de personas en todo el mundo. Su importancia y relevancia tanto en la vida cotidiana como en el ámbito profesional lo hacen digno de análisis y reflexión. A lo largo de la historia, el GiFT ha sido objeto de debate y controversia, y ha evolucionado de acuerdo con las necesidades y demandas de la sociedad. En este artículo, exploraremos diferentes aspectos del GiFT, desde su origen hasta su impacto en la actualidad, así como también analizaremos su influencia en diversos campos como la política, la economía, la cultura y la tecnología.
giFT | ||
---|---|---|
![]() | ||
Información general | ||
Tipo de programa | software libre | |
Desarrollador | jasta | |
Lanzamiento inicial | 2003 | |
Licencia | GNU GPL | |
Información técnica | ||
Programado en | C | |
Versiones | ||
Última versión estable | 0.11.8.127 de noviembre de 2004 | |
Enlaces | ||
giFT es un dominio (programa de computadora o servicio) creado para servir de nexo entre los distintos protocolos de redes de distribución de archivos y una interfaz gráfica. Utiliza plugins para cargar dinámicamente los diferentes protocolos a medida que un cliente lo solicite.
Los clientes que implementen interfaces gráficas para giFT se comunican con el proceso usando un protocolo de red ligero. Esto permite que el código del protocolo de red sea abstraído de la interfaz de usuario. giFT es escrito utilizando código multiplataforma C, que significa que puede ser compilado y ejecutado en una gran variedad de sistemas operativos. Existen varias GUI para OS como Microsoft Windows, Apple y Unix-like.
giFT (giFT Internet File Transfer) es un acrónimo recursivo, que quiere decir que una de las letras representa el propio acrónimo.
Uno de los inconvenientes del núcleo de giFT es que actualmente carece de soporte unicode, lo que impide el intercambio de archivos con nombres que contengan caracteres unicode (como "ø","ä", "å", "é" etc). También, giFT carece de muchas características necesarias para usar la red Gnutella efectivamente.
Los protocolos soportados actualmente por giFT son: Gnutella, Ares Galaxy y OpenFT. Un plugin para FastTrack (el protocolo utilizado por Kazaa) se encuentra en estado beta, mientras que otro para OpenNap se encuentra en etapa temprana de desarrollo.
El proyecto giFT se encuentra fuertemente ligado al proyecto OpenFT, una reimplementación del protocolo FastTrack producido a través del conocimiento adquirido de la ingeniería inversa de FastTrack. OpenFT implementa nodos de búsqueda y supernodos índices al igual que FastTrack.
Nombre | Plataforma |
---|---|
giFTcurs | Unix-like; Soporte Oficial de la IU |
Apollon | Unix-like/KDE |
FilePipe | Microsoft Windows |
giFToxic | Unix-like |
giFTui | Unix-like |
giFTwin32 | Microsoft Windows |
KCeasy | Microsoft Windows |
Poisoned | Mac OS X |
Xfactor | Mac OS X |
Para la comunicación con la interfaz gráfica utiliza un protocolo liviano, el cual permite una abstracción completa del protocolo de red utilizado. Existen múltiples interfaces disponibles para giFT, tanto para Windows, Macintosh o GNU/Linux.